タグ付けされた質問 「linux」

Linuxは知名度の高いコンピュータオペレーティングシステムです。Raspberry Piは、多数のLinuxディストリビューションの1つを実行できます。最も普及しているのは、Raspbian(Debianベース)およびArch Linuxです。

2
Pi搭載OBD-IIコンピューター
私は最近、Arduino UnoでOBDuino32kを構築しました。残念ながら、間違ったインターフェイスを作成したため、車では使用できません。ELMの代わりにISOのインターフェースを作成しました。 先日Raspberry Piを購入しましたが、OBD-IIからDB9へのケーブルをすでに構築しているので、それを使用してプロジェクトを完了する方法があるのではないかと考えています。Piで実行されるLinux OBDソフトウェアを知っている人はいますか?検索を始めましたが、まだ何も思いつきません。ここに投稿された進捗を維持します。このコミュニティが提供できる洞察は大歓迎です。
13 hardware  linux 

10
Raspberry piでのSSH「接続拒否」-理由を見つけることができません
SSHの「接続が拒否されました」という問題があります。それは正常に動作しますが、SSHで作業している間、「接続が拒否されました」と表示され、再接続する必要があります(これは5〜10分間は発生しません)。私はすべてを試しました(Linuxを再起動し、sshを再起動します)が、それでも助けにはなりません。私はvar / logもチェックしましたが、そこには何も役に立ちません... 注:私が見つけた興味深いメモは、sshを外部IP(277 ...)にしようとすると、黒いcmd画面に移動し、これを閉じて192.168.0.13アドレスを試すとサインインできますが、短いです一方、再び接続が拒否されました...もちろん、サーバーを開いてsudo sshdを再起動すると、sshの「接続拒否」がなくなります... 私のsshポートは23で開かれ、モデム/ルーターにも設定されています sudpi@raspberrypi:~$ sudo netstat -tlpn Active Internet connections (only servers) Proto Recv-Q Send-Q Local Address Foreign Address State PID/Program name tcp 0 0 0.0.0.0:80 0.0.0.0:* LISTEN 1817/apache2 tcp 0 0 0.0.0.0:21 0.0.0.0:* LISTEN 2227/vsftpd tcp 0 0 127.0.0.1:3350 0.0.0.0:* LISTEN 1784/xrdp-sesman tcp 0 0 …
13 linux  ssh 

2
ramdiskを含むカーネルイメージ(.img)の構築
次の手順で、Raspberry Pi用のLinuxカーネル(3.0.1)を構築しました。 1. Downloading kernel source 2. tar xvf source.tar.bz2 3. downloading arm cross compilation tool. 4. tar xvf arm-2010q1-202-arm-none-linux-gnueabi-i686-pc-linux-gnu.tar.bz2 5. setting up path for cross tool export PATH=$PATH:/home/shan/<cross tool folder>/bin/ 6. after entering linux source dir make ARCH=arm versatile_defconfig (is this reliable with raspberry pi) 7. make ARCH=arm CROSS_COMPILE=arm-none-linux-gnueabi- …

2
vcgencmdコマンドとは何ですか?
私はそれが何をするか知っています、しかしその名前は何を意味しますか?頭字語ですか?Linuxを初めて使う人に、vcgencmdをどのように説明しますか?
12 linux 

3
USBマイクRaspberry Pi
私はRaspberry Pi 3を使用しています。私がしようとしていることは、USBマイクをテストすることです。最初に入力しlsusbて、ラズベリーpiがデバイスを検出するかどうかを確認します。それはあり、結果はこれです: BUS 001デバイスoo8:ID 0d8c:013c C-Media Electronics、Inc. CM108オーディオコントローラー 次に、コマンドalsamixerを入力してデバイスを選択し、音量を上げます。その後、コマンドarecord -lを入力してCAPTURE Hardware Devicesのリストを取得します。 カード1:デバイス[USB PnPサウンドデバイス]、 デバイス0:USBオーディオ[USBオーディオ] サブデバイス:1/1サブデバイス#0:サブデバイス#0。 マイクが音声を録音しているのがわかりますが、ヘッドフォンを接続しても音声が聞こえません。
11 usb  audio  linux 

1
Linuxでラズベリーpiをすばやく起動する方法は?
Linuxを使用して、pi zeroをすばやく(1秒未満で)起動させたい。その場合、それは組み込みコントローラーであり、標準的な本格的な(しかし遅い)コンピューターではないふりをすることができます。 この目標を達成する方法(追加)のヒントはありますか? 私がすでに試したこと: さまざまなオプション(カーネルパラメータ、標準ディストリビューションのカスタムカーネル-arch、raspbian、systemdなどの調整など)-すべてが一般的に遅い ブートローダーのチェーンの変更に関するリソースを見つけましたが、現在このレベルでは調整できません 私が到達できる最高の結果はbuildrootによって提供されました 次のルールを使用すると、(約)4秒以内に起動できますが、それでも遅くなります。 initrdを使用しない モジュールを使用しない(カーネルに必要なドライバーを埋め込む) 複数のデバイスを使用しないでください(lvm) レイドを使用しない デバッグを使用しない debugfs カーネルデバッグ(カーネルハック) PCI / PCMCIAを使用しない SATA / ATAを使用しない 起動ロゴを使用しない のような本格的なCライブラリを使用しないでください glibc サイズの最適化を使用しない 構成 cmdline.txt シリアルコンソールを使用しないでください: 削除console=xxx、ここでxxxはシリアルポートです 編集/etc/inittab(getty spawn) セットアップルートファイルタイプ: rootfstype=ext4 config.txt 起動遅延を使用しないでください: boot_delay=0 虹を使わない: disable_splash=1 セーフモードを気にしない: avoid_safe_mode=1
11 boot  linux  kernel  buildroot 

3
Raspberry piのカスタムOSをゼロから構築する方法は?
カーネルと組み込みLinuxは初めてです。私は最近Raspberry Piを購入し、Raspbianを使用して起動しました。私はPiに魅了されました。Embeddedの詳細を学ぶために、ホームオートメーションシステムを作ることにしました。自分のカーネルとスタックを使いたかった。つまり、どのOSも使用したくありません。 そのために、公式のgithubからカーネル、target_fs、ファームウェア、ツールチェーンをダウンロードしています。ツールチェーンを使用してカーネルをコンパイルしました。 現在、これを新しいsdカード(フレッシュスタート用にフォーマット済み)に配置する方法がわかりません。スタックを起動する前に注意しなければならないことは何ですか?sshまたはtelnetサーバー/クライアントを配置していないため、起動が成功したことをどのようにして知ることができますか。piのssh / telnetデーモンはどこで入手できますか?私の目的は、Raspberry Piのカーネル(または最低限)のみを起動することです。

1
Raspberry Pi用の最小限のLinuxを構築する
Raspberry Piを手に入れました。私は経験豊富なアプリケーションソフトウェア開発者ですが、ハードウェアや低レベルのプログラミングをこれまでに行ったことはありません。Pi上のすべてのハードウェア用のドライバーを含む最小限のLinuxを構築したいと思います。学習のために、事前に構築されたLinuxディストリビューションをPiにインストールしたくありません。どこから始めればいいですか?
10 setup  linux 

2
Raspberry Piの/ dev / vchiqとは何ですか?
私はRaspberry Pi 3とraspbian jessieを使用しています。RiPiで音楽を再生するプログラム(omxplayer)をperg-cgiで呼び出そうとして、/ dev / vchiqに遭遇しました。そして、私はそれを機能させることができませんでした。 ブラウザ(例:localhost / muzikica / pusti.pl)[apache2]で開いたとき、「vchiqインスタンスを開けませんでした」と表示されました。そのため、/ dev / vchiqファイルのアクセス許可をxx7に変更し、RiPiを再起動しないまで機能しました。/ dev / vchiqはビデオグループの一部であるため、それを理解し、www-data(私のpusti.plスクリプトが呼び出すプログラムを実行しているユーザー)をビデオグループに追加しました。そしてそれはうまくいった! では、/ dev / vchiq xDとは一体何なのか、そしてwww-dataがRaspberry Piでサウンドを再生するために少なくとも読み取りと書き込みのアクセス許可を必要とするのはなぜですか? 前もって感謝します。
10 raspbian  pi-3  linux  arm 

2
Javaを使用してヘッダーピンにデータを読み書きする方法は?
私のRaspberry PiでJavaを実行したところ、思ったよりもずっとねじ込みました。Javaからヘッダーピンにデータを読み書きできるようにしたい。これどうやってするの?ヘッダーピンからデータを取得するために、最初にCでドライバーまたは何らかのソートを作成する必要がありますか?Soft-float Debian「wheezy」のインスタンスを実行しています。これはJavaでも可能ですか?知っておくべき回避策はありますか?読んでいただきありがとうございます!
9 gpio  linux  java  c 

1
SSHがデフォルトのユーザーディレクトリを表示しない
最近、RaspbianをRaspberry Piにインストールしました。インストールプロセスの一環として、私は自分のデフォルト(PI)からユーザー名とグループを変更し使用して(のは、ユーザーにそれを呼びましょう)usermodとgroupmod。また、を使用してホームディレクトリ/home/piを新しいユーザー名に移動/home/userしましたusermod。新しいユーザーディレクトリ/home/userを表示する代わりにSSHを使用してログインすると、ホームディレクトリに到達することを除いて、すべてが正常に機能します/home。 /home/user権限が755のディレクトリが存在するのと同じです。それに加えて、/etc/passwdファイルには次のようなエントリが含まれています。 user:x:1000:1000:User:/ home / user:/ bin / bash。 私にはすべて問題なく見えますが、それでもSSHからログインすると、次のようなプロンプトが表示されます。 user @ raspberrypi / home $。 なぜこれが起こっているのか、または簡単な解決策はありますか?それは大したことではありませんが、それは私を混乱させます。
8 raspbian  ssh  linux 
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.